The ABB PP820, also cataloged as the PP820 Operator Panel, operates as a dedicated hardware component for localized human-machine interface interaction and data visualization within industrial automation and process networks.
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Model | PP820 |
| Brand | ABB |
| Origin | Sweden |
| Product Type | Human Machine Interfaces |
| Display Subsystem Type | FSTN Monochrome LCD |
| Display Resolution | 260 x 64 pixels |
| Core Internal Processor | 32-bit CPU, 400 MHz |
| Volatile Storage Capacity | 64 MB |
| Operational Power Input | 24 VDC |
| Active Power Consumption | 5 W |
| System Configuration Tools | ABB Control Builder, ABB Panel Builder Software |
| Embedded Communication Profiles | Modbus, Profinet, ABB AC800M, ABB AC500, Third-Party PLCs |
| Enclosure Ingress Protection | IP65 / IP66 Rated Front Facing |
| Structural Enclosure Type | Shock, vibration, and corrosion resistant metal housing |
| Physical Mounting Format | Standard panel cut-out panel-mount installation |
| Operating Temperature Range | -10 to 60 deg C |
| Operating Humidity Limits | 10% to 95% non-condensing |
| Mechanical Dimensions | 202 mm x 187 mm x 6 mm |
| Weight | 1.4 kg |
The interface terminal establishes peer-to-peer data links with central logic controllers via integrated fieldbus ports, matching standard backplane bus communication velocity baselines. It provides full communication sync across Profinet and Modbus serial or Ethernet structures, handling real-time status arrays from connected ABB AC800M or AC500 controller chassis. The high-performance 400 MHz processing architecture maps user-configured tag registers instantly, keeping internal processing latencies under nominal thresholds during extensive I/O density scaling routines. Complete firmware flash compatibility with Panel Builder software tools allows engineers to deploy updated application screens and register maps without interrupting parallel control loop logic execution.
Q: What action fields can be mapped to the front tactile switches on the PP820?
A: The front panel includes programmable mechanical function keys that can be hardcoded via Panel Builder software to trigger immediate logic overrides. These are typically dedicated to critical field tasks such as engine start, sequence stop, system reset, or localized emergency signaling.
Q: How does the display matrix handle readability under variable environmental lighting conditions?
A: The module incorporates a high-contrast FSTN monochrome LCD layout with a 260 x 64 pixel resolution. This presentation layout ensures crisp alphanumeric process visualization and variable angle readability across the entire -10 to 60 deg C temperature spectrum.
